Two TiVo Developments

Posted on Friday 1 June 2007

TiVo GuyTwo neat developments with TiVo this week. First, the “Series 3″ — the high definition, stand-alone model (that is, it works with cable TV services without requiring a separate cable box) — has been sighted on Amazon for about $400 after rebate. Still expensive, but far cheaper than when it debuted late last year for $800.

Second, per Ars Technica, TiVo’s CEO announced that they will release “a mass appeal priced HD unit…later this year.”

All good news for TiVo fans like me.
